A customer asked me the other day if he boiled acid water, would it become more neutral or remain acidic. I hadn’t done this test before, and I didn’t know. So, I got some acid water from my Athena water ionizer and boiled it to find out what happened. Here’s the video:
For water ionizer owners who aren’t able to watch the above video, here’s the results. The acid water started out at 3.3 pH and after boiling and cooling down enough to test it, the water tested at 3.5 pH. So almost no change was made in the water’s acidity.
On the other hand, whenever I’ve boiled alkaline water and let it cool, and tested it, I’ve seen drastic changes in the pH and ORP [like going from a 10 pH down to a 6].
